The chemically purified multiwalled carbon nanotube/poly(vinylidene fluoride) (MWCNT/PVDF) composites were fabricated. Raman spectroscopy and transmission electron microscopy micrographs indicated that the catalysts metal particles and amorphous carbon had been removed from the purified MWCNTs. The percolation threshold of the composites is relatively large. about 3.8 vol.%. The most important result is that the dielectric constant of the composires is enhanced remarkably, and the dielectric constant of 3600 is obtained in the composite with 8 vol.% purified MWCNT at 1 kHz. The large dielectric constant can be attributed to the preparation procedure and the interface effect between the MWCNTs and the polymer. (c) 2008 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
